Fat and chocolate create richness
More butter and melted chocolate produce a dense, rich brownie. Extra flour and aerated eggs move the texture towards cake.
Mix with intention
For a glossy top, briefly whisk sugar and eggs well, but fold in the flour only until it disappears.
- Fudgy: less flour and a shorter bake.
- Cakey: a little more flour and often a raising agent.
- Chewy: brown sugar and enough egg help.
Cut only after cooling
The centre continues to set as it cools. For neat squares, use a cool knife and wipe it between cuts.
